My winter indoor garden really helps cheer and 'ground' (!) me. We get dwarf Bok Choy, mustards, arugula and mini lettuces to supplement our salads of raw local red and green cabbage, carrots, apples and home baked beans Just seeing the growth and tending to the seedlings and growing plants, then snipping the leaves when they're ready helps defeat the winter blues. I have to try to pace the sowings so that the harvests don't all come at once.

This photo of a mouse was taken by a friend, in the cafeteria of the main hospital in Halifax, Canada! *
More mice were apparently spotted by this friend at the emergency dept in the Infirmary.
This is the same hospital where patients are advised against drinking or brushing teeth etc in water from the tap. The pipes are contaminated with Legionella.
And the same one where patients are practically suffocating in summer heat as they can't put air conditioners on the floors due to concerns over air quality.
